Salt Air Corrosion: The Hidden Revenue Driver for Skidaway Island HVAC Specialists

How coastal salt exposure creates premium service opportunities year-round

Skidaway Island's location directly on the Georgia coast creates a persistent challenge for HVAC systems through salt air corrosion that impacts outdoor units at an accelerated rate compared to inland Savannah properties. This environmental factor forces more frequent coil replacements, compressor failures, and complete unit replacements every 7-10 years rather than the industry standard 12-15 years. Savvy HVAC contractors on Skidaway Island who invest in corrosion-resistant materials and specialize in salt mitigation techniques can command 20-30% premium pricing while establishing themselves as the go-to experts for the island's 3,000+ homes. The Landings homeowners association, comprising the majority of the island's residential properties, actively maintains a preferred vendor list of HVAC contractors who demonstrate specialized knowledge of coastal equipment maintenance, creating a predictable pipeline of commercial maintenance contracts alongside residential service calls.

  • Salt corrosion reduces HVAC lifespan by 30-40% in coastal environments
  • The Landings HOA requires specialized corrosion-resistant equipment for all vendor installations
  • Island homeowners report 2.3x higher replacement frequency for condenser units compared to inland properties
  • Corrosion protection treatments can extend equipment life by 5-7 years with proper maintenance

Humidity Control: Year-Round HVAC Demand in Skidaway Island's Tropical Climate

How Georgia's coastal humidity creates non-seasonal service opportunities

Unlike inland Georgia areas where HVAC demand follows distinct seasonal patterns, Skidaway Island's tropical climate maintains 65-85% humidity levels throughout the year, creating consistent humidity-related HVAC service opportunities that don't follow traditional summer/winter cycles. This persistent moisture load forces homeowners to continuously address condensation issues, mold prevention, and indoor air quality concerns, resulting in 40% more humidity control service calls than the national average. Smart HVAC contractors operating here have developed specialized humidity management packages that combine dehumidifier maintenance with advanced filtration systems, creating predictable recurring revenue streams from Skidaway Island's year-round tropical conditions. The island's mix of full-time residents and seasonal homeowners (especially during peak summer months) creates two distinct customer profiles with different humidity-related service needs, allowing contractors to tailor their offerings accordingly while maintaining steady workloads across all seasons.

Salt Air Corrosion: A Steady Pipeline for Coastal Service Providers

Salt air is relentless. Coastal properties experience accelerated corrosion of metal components, degradation of exterior finishes, and premature failure of roofing materials at rates 3-5x faster than inland equivalents. This environmental constant creates a maintenance cycle that coastal property owners cannot escape — and that funds a perpetual demand pipeline for service providers positioned in these markets.

The business implications are significant. A coastal property that might need exterior repainting every 10-12 years inland requires the same service every 4-6 years. HVAC condensers, metal flashing, fasteners, and railings all corrode faster, generating replacement demand on compressed timelines. For lead buyers, coastal territories produce higher repeat-customer rates and shorter intervals between service calls, making the lifetime value of each acquired lead substantially higher than inland equivalents.

Humidity and Mold: The Hidden Demand Driver in Warm Climates

Mold growth in humid climates is not an occasional problem — it is a persistent condition that drives continuous demand for remediation, prevention, and monitoring services. When outdoor relative humidity consistently exceeds 60%, interior mold growth becomes nearly inevitable in any space with inadequate ventilation or minor moisture intrusion. The health implications make mold remediation one of the highest-urgency service categories, with consumers acting quickly once the problem is identified.

For service providers, mold-related work in humid markets offers several business advantages. Lead quality is high because consumers rarely comparison-shop when faced with visible mold growth — they want it resolved immediately. Project values are substantial, averaging $2,000-$8,000 for residential remediation. And recurrence rates mean that satisfied customers frequently return or refer neighbors facing the same persistent challenge. Lead buyers in humid-climate territories should expect mold-related inquiries to comprise 15-25% of their total restoration lead volume.

Cross-Selling Exterior Services in Coastal Markets

Coastal properties deteriorate faster than inland equivalents across virtually every exterior surface. Salt air, UV exposure, wind-driven rain, and sand abrasion attack roofing, siding, paint, windows, and decking simultaneously. This creates a natural cross-selling environment where a customer requesting one exterior service almost certainly needs two or three others within the same maintenance cycle.

Providers who structure their estimates to include a comprehensive exterior assessment — rather than narrowly quoting only the requested service — capture significantly more revenue per lead. A homeowner calling about a roof leak may not realize their siding is also compromised, their deck sealant has failed, and their exterior paint is chalking. The provider who identifies and presents the full scope of needed work wins on both ticket size and customer satisfaction, because the homeowner avoids multiple disruptions from separate contractors.

The ROI of Speed-to-Lead in Service Businesses

Every minute of delay between lead creation and first provider contact reduces conversion probability by approximately 10%. A lead contacted within 5 minutes converts at roughly 8x the rate of one contacted after 30 minutes. For a service business purchasing leads at $50-$100 each, the difference between a 5-minute and 30-minute response time is the difference between a profitable lead channel and a money-losing one.

Measuring speed-to-lead ROI requires tracking three metrics: average response time, contact rate (percentage of leads reached on first attempt), and appointment-set rate. Providers who monitor these metrics and invest in reducing response time — through dedicated intake staff, automated text responses, and streamlined scheduling tools — consistently achieve 2-3x the return on their lead investment compared to providers who treat lead response as a secondary priority.

Why Phone-Verified Leads Convert at 3x the Rate

The quality gap between phone-verified leads and unverified form submissions is one of the most consistent findings in lead generation analytics. Leads where the consumer has spoken to a live person and confirmed their intent, timeline, and contact information convert at approximately 3x the rate of raw form fills. The verification process filters out tire-kickers, incorrect contact information, and spam submissions before the lead reaches the service provider.

For service providers, the implications are clear: paying more for verified leads almost always produces better unit economics than buying cheaper unverified leads in bulk. A verified lead at $75 that converts at 45% costs $167 per acquisition. An unverified lead at $30 that converts at 15% costs $200 per acquisition — more expensive despite the lower sticker price. Lead buyers who evaluate lead sources on verified conversion rates rather than per-lead cost consistently achieve superior return on their marketing investment.
